Whiplash is defined as a rapid back-and-forth movement of the neck that causes strain or a sprain. Whiplash most often occurs as a result of auto accidents and can be responsible for pain from neck movement, headaches, fatigue and dizziness, and sleep disturbances. A doctor should be seen for any symptoms of whiplash or neck pain as soon as possible as whiplash can lead to serious complications such as severe neck pain that spreads, memory problems, and even blurred vision.
Whiplash generally takes between a few weeks to heal with proper treatment, but can last much longer if undiagnosed. Recovery from whiplash usually involves frequent physical therapy and time off from work. In Winter Springs, your personal insurance provides initial coverage following an accident, regardless of fault determination. However, this system contains restrictions most people don’t anticipate. Your PIP benefits cover only 80% of medical expenses and 60% of wage losses, capped at merely $10,000 total. When dealing with serious injuries, these funds are quickly exhausted. Additionally, PIP provides no compensation for pain and suffering damages. Winter Springs mandates only $10,000 in PIP coverage and $10,000 in property damage protection. These amounts prove woefully inadequate for serious collisions. Many drivers carry insufficient insurance. An attorney can identify all available coverage sources including your underinsured motorist benefits, umbrella policies, or health insurance coordination.
